site stats

Slurm reservation gpu

WebbSlurm supports the use of GPUs via the concept of Generic Resources (GRES)—these are computing resources associated with a Slurm node, which can be used to perform jobs. Slurm provides GRE plugins for many types of GPUs. Here are several notable features of Slurm: Scales to tens of thousands of GPGPUs and millions of cores. WebbIntroduction. To request one or more GPUs for a Slurm job, use this form: --gpus-per-node= [type:]number. The square-bracket notation means that you must specify the number of GPUs, and you may optionally specify the GPU type. Choose a type from the "Available hardware" table below. Here are two examples: --gpus-per-node=2 --gpus-per-node=v100:1.

Allocating Memory Princeton Research Computing

WebbSlurm options for GPU resources Job Submission When you submit a job with Slurm on Liger, you must specify: A partition which defines the type of compute nodes you wish to … Webb28 dec. 2024 · For example: RuntimeError: CUDA out of memory. Tried to allocate 4.50 MiB (GPU 0; 11.91 GiB total capacity; 213.75 MiB already allocated; 11.18 GiB free; 509.50 KiB cached) This is what has led me to the conclusion that the GPU has not been properly cleared after a previously running job has finished. fishing rods at big w https://shekenlashout.com

8777 – Slurm not restricting GPUs with gres param "gpu:1"

Webb这样,我们告诉DeepSpeed只使用GPU1(第二块GPU)。 在多个节点上部署. 本节中的信息并非特定于 DeepSpeed 的集成,而是适用于任何多节点程序。但是DeepSpeed提供了 … WebbSlurm supports the use of GPUs via the concept of Generic Resources (GRES)—these are computing resources associated with a Slurm node, which can be used to perform jobs. … WebbA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. fishing rods and reels at walmart

Ubuntu Manpage: scontrol - view or modify Slurm configuration …

Category:sinfo(1) - man.freebsd.org

Tags:Slurm reservation gpu

Slurm reservation gpu

Reference - Liger Docs - Institut national de physique nucléaire et …

Webb11 apr. 2016 · Slurm's obviously not anticipated being put in control of just some GPUs in the cluster, while not being meant to intervene on other nodes. There are a few approaches you can take here: 1) Start managing those GPUs through GRES. Easiest option from Slurm's perspective. WebbIf you need more or less than this then you need to explicitly set the amount in your Slurm script. The most common way to do this is with the following Slurm directive: #SBATCH --mem-per-cpu=8G # memory per cpu-core. An alternative directive to specify the required memory is. #SBATCH --mem=2G # total memory per node.

Slurm reservation gpu

Did you know?

WebbSLURM_NPROCS - total number of CPUs allocated Resource Requests To run you job, you will need to specify what resources you need. These can be memory, cores, nodes, gpus, etc. There is a lot of flexibility in the scheduler to get specifically the resources you need. --nodes - The number of nodes for the job (computers)

Webb教程4:使用现有模型进行训练和测试. MMSegmentation 支持在多种设备上训练和测试模型。. 如下文,具体方式分别为单GPU、分布式以及计算集群的训练和测试。. 通过本教程,您将知晓如何用 MMSegmentation 提供的脚本进行训练和测试。. Webb11 aug. 2024 · 初衷 首先,slurm搭建的初衷是为了将我多个GPU机器连接起来,从来利用多台机器的计算能力,提高计算效率,之前使用过deepops去搭建,结果最后好像deepops对GPU的卡有要求,我的每台机器卡都不一样,所以后面就开始研究slurm集群的方式了。1、参考文档 之前参考过诸多文档,中间会出现各种奇怪的 ...

WebbSlurm (Simple Linux Utility for Resource Management) is a free and open-source job scheduler for Linux and Unix-like kernels, used by many of the world's supercomputers and compute clusters. Slurm's design is very modular with about 100 optional plugins. Webb21 sep. 2024 · Illustration of a SLURM reservation of 4 nodes and 3 GPUs per node, equalling 12 processes. The collective inter-node communications are managed by the NCCL library. To execute a …

WebbSlurm客户节点配置,有两种模式: 传统模式:客户节点采用 /etc/slurm/ 目录下的 slurm.conf 等配置文件进行配置。 无配置 (configless)模式:客户节点无需配置 /etc/slurm 目录下相应的配置文件。...

Webb18 apr. 2024 · 全部。 在我的 Slurm 集群中,当 srun 或 sbatch 作业请求多个节点的资源时,将无法正确提交。 这个 Slurm 集群有 个节点,每个节点有 个 GPU。 我可以同时使用 个 GPU 执行多个作业。 但我无法运行 个或更多 GPU 的作业请求。 下面的信息会显示cise 状态 … fishing rods and tackle on a payment schemeWebbJobs Scheduling with SLURM. ... For example if you submit job to the gpu-2080ti partition that used 10 CPUs, 50G RAM, 1 GPU then: cost=MAX(10 * 0.278,50 * 0.0522,1 * 2.5)=2.78. ... Accounting and fairshare will be based on the amount of resources you are blocking and not on what you reserve: ... fishing rod set for sale philippinesWebb19 sep. 2024 · GPU parallel development support: CUDA, OpenCL, OpenACC. WestGrid Webinar 2024-Sep-19 15 / 46 Hardware Connecting ... (per core or total) I if applicable, number of GPUs I Slurm partition, reservation, software licenses ... fishing rod sets ukWebb10 okt. 2024 · are not specified when a reservation is created, Slurm will: automatically select nodes to avoid overlap and ensure that: the selected nodes are available when the … cancellation fee gold\u0026apos s gymWebbIn the console, allocate a GPU with the command: interactive -n 1 -c 9 --gpus-per-task=v100:1 -t 60 -A --reservation=gpu This allocates 1 task comprising 9 CPU cores and 1 V100 GPU for 60 minutes using your project account (i.e. you should fill in something like LiU-gpu-XXXX-YYYYY), i.e. a quarter of a node is allocated. cancellation fee for xfinity serviceWebb26 juli 2024 · slurm_gpustat slurm_gpustat是一个简单的命令行实用程序,可汇总在slurm群集上使用GPU。 该工具可以通过两种方式使用: 查询集群上GPU的当前使用情况。 启动一个守护程序,该守护程序将记录一段时间内的使用情况。 以后可以查询此日志以提供使用情况统计信息。 fishing rod sensitivity subjectiveWebb前言. 在讲解使用 slurm 启动 DDP 之前,我们首先讲解如何一步一步地安装 slurm 集群。. 安装 slurm 集群需要管理员权限,请确保您能够获取到它。. 我们的 slurm 集群由 2 台服务器组成,IP 分别是 192.168.1.105(master 节点),192.168.1.106(slave 节点)。. fishing rod set